The following table lists the files and folders for the Windows version of JP1/AJS3 Console Manager according to their uses.
- How to read the tables
- The tables listing files and folders use the following abbreviations:
- CM_Path: JP1/AJS3 Console installation folder
- CM_Data_Path (for Windows Server 2008): %ALLUSERSPROFILE%\HITACHI\JP1\JP1_DEFAULT\JP1AJS2CM
- CM_Data_Path (for Windows Server 2003): JP1/AJS3 Console installation folder
- SystemDrive: System drive
- The default value for %ALLUSERSPROFILE% is system-drive\ProgramData.
- By default, CM_Path is SystemDrive\Program files\Hitachi\JP1AJS2CM.
Table A-41 Files that the user can create and modify (JP1/AJS3 Console Manager for Windows)
Item File or folder name Environment settings file for JP1/AJS3 Console Manager
- CM_Path\conf\ajs2cm.conf
Table A-42 Files and folders that the user can reference (JP1/AJS3 Console Manager for Windows)
Item File or folder name Execution file storage folder
- CM_Path\bin\
Environment settings file storage folder
- CM_Path\conf\
Environment settings model file for JP1/AJS3 Console Manager
- CM_Path\conf\ajs2cm.conf.model
Table A-43 Files and folders that the user does not need to modify or reference (JP1/AJS3 Console Manager for Windows)
Item File or folder name Data directory
- CM_Data_Path\database
File for the creation of JP1/AJS3 Console Manager environment settings model file
- CM_Path\conf\ajs2cm.conf.model.model
Table A-44 Log files and folders (JP1/AJS3 Console Manager for Windows)
Item File or folder name Trace log
- CM_Data_Path\log\tracelog.cm
(2) In UNIX
The following table lists the files and directories for the UNIX version of JP1/AJS3 Console Manager according to their uses.
Table A-45 Files that the user can create and modify (JP1/AJS3 Console Manager for UNIX)
Item File or folder name Environment settings file for JP1/AJS3 Console Manager
- /etc/opt/jp1ajs2cm/conf/ajs2cm.conf
Table A-46 Files and directories that the user can reference (JP1/AJS3 Console Manager for UNIX)
Item File or directory name Execution file storage directory
- /opt/jp1ajs2cm/bin/
- /opt/jp1ajs2cm/lib/
Message catalog
- /opt/jp1ajs2cm/lib/nls/$LANG
Environment settings file storage directory
- /etc/opt/jp1ajs2cm/conf/
Environment settings model file for JP1/AJS3 Console Manager
- /etc/opt/jp1ajs2cm/conf/ajs2cm.conf.model
Table A-47 Files and directories that the user does not need to modify or reference (JP1/AJS3 Console Manager for UNIX)
Item File or folder name Data directory
- /etc/opt/jp1ajs2cm/conf/ajs2cm.conf
Table A-48 Log files and directories (JP1/AJS3 Console Manager for UNIX)
Item File or directory name Trace log
- /var/opt/jp1ajs2cm/log/tracelog.cm
- Supplementary notes
- The user (generally, root) who created a trace log file first becomes its owner.
- In AIX, root/system is the owner of trace log files.
